Rabies Vaccination for Dogs in India
Overview
Rabies is one of the most serious infectious diseases affecting both animals and humans. Once symptoms develop, rabies is almost always fatal.
India continues to report a significant number of rabies cases each year, making vaccination one of the most important responsibilities of every dog owner.
Fortunately, rabies vaccination is safe, effective, and widely available.
What Is Rabies?
Rabies is a viral disease that affects the nervous system.
The virus attacks the brain and spinal cord, eventually causing severe neurological symptoms and death.
Rabies affects:
- Dogs
- Cats
- Wildlife
- Humans
Vaccination remains the most effective preventive measure.
How Rabies Spreads
Rabies is primarily transmitted through:
- Bites from infected animals
- Saliva entering wounds
- Contact with infected nervous tissue
Dogs can become infected through contact with rabid animals.

Puppy Rabies Vaccination Schedule
Most veterinarians recommend:
First Rabies Vaccine
At approximately:
- 12–16 weeks of age
The exact timing may vary depending on local veterinary recommendations.
Booster Vaccination Schedule
First Booster
Usually administered:
- One year after the initial vaccination
Subsequent Boosters
Typically:
- Annually
- According to vaccine manufacturer recommendations
Consult your veterinarian regarding the appropriate schedule.
Signs of Rabies in Dogs
Possible symptoms include:
- Behavioral changes
- Aggression
- Excessive drooling
- Difficulty swallowing
- Paralysis
- Seizures
Once symptoms appear, rabies is almost always fatal.
What To Do If Your Dog Is Bitten
If your dog is bitten by another animal:
- Seek veterinary attention immediately.
- Clean the wound carefully.
- Verify vaccination status.
- Follow veterinary quarantine recommendations.
Prompt action is essential.

Cost of Rabies Vaccination in India
Typical costs range from:
- ₹300 to ₹1,000
Costs vary depending on:
- City
- Veterinary clinic
- Vaccine brand
Rabies vaccination is generally one of the most affordable preventive healthcare services.
